In 1990, Honda wished to develop a new minivan for the U.S. market. Specifically, they decided to establish a new U.S. plant one powered by the V6 engine from the upscale Acura Legend. The plan reflected a strong desire by Koichi Amemiya, president of American Honda,
to set a new standard for that growing segment of the American market. The Odyssey, after having overcome numerous obstacles, was finally launched on October 20, 1994.

Cleaning car mats should follow some basic steps. You should vacuum your carpets each time you wash the car. First, take out the mats, and vacuum them. Use the vacuum attachments to suck up the grit and gravel in the hard-to-reach places under the seats. Use the upholstery nozzle on the seats, headliner, and doors.
This prevents the grit from shoes wearing the carpet down. Generally, you should vacuum from the top down. The grime you miss will end up on the floor and you'll catch it when you get there. In some cases, you might have to use upholstery and matg
cleaning spray to help with the really dirty spots. |
